Perfect pairing: smoked sausage with cheese

When it comes to pairing sausage with cheese, there are several options that can enhance the flavors and create a delicious combination. One of the key factors to consider is the type of cheese that complements the smoky and savory taste of the sausage. Smooth, semi-soft cheeses like Havarti, butterkäse, or Muenster are perfect choices. These cheeses have a neutral background that allows the sausage's seasonings to shine. Additionally, a sharp Cheddar or Swiss cheese can also be a fantastic match, with nutty notes that perfectly complement the smoke and acidity of the sausage.

Adding Cheese to Sausage: The Perfect Technique

Adding cheese to sausage can be a messy affair if the cheese doesn't hold up to the cooking and smoking temperatures. However, there are specific types of cheese that are made to withstand these conditions. To achieve the perfect balance of flavors and textures, it is recommended to use one pound of cheese per 10-12 pounds of meat or 10% of the product weight. Simply add the cheese to the ground meat right before stuffing. If you have any excess product, it can be frozen for later use. For best results, freeze the cheese flat.
